Description
The Illusis is a semi-flush ceiling light with eight G9 bulb fittings housed within a 405mm diameter polished chrome canopy, from which approximately 200 clear glass spheres cascade on thin nylon threads. The spheres vary in size from 10mm to 40mm diameter and hang at different lengths, creating a waterfall effect that extends roughly 250mm below the ceiling plate.
Designed for rooms with standard 2.4m ceiling heights where a full chandelier drop would hang too low, the semi-flush design keeps the main body close to the ceiling while the glass sphere droplets add decorative depth. The fitting suits entrance halls, dining rooms above a table, and living rooms where ambient light needs to be paired with decorative presence. The eight G9 sockets take halogen or LED capsule bulbs (sold separately), allowing control over light temperature and brightness.
Each glass sphere is hand-threaded onto individual nylon lines attached to the chrome canopy, so the droplets move slightly in air currents from doors opening or heating. The polished chrome reflects light from the bulbs back through the glass, amplifying the sparkle effect when the fitting is switched on. The nylon threads are designed to hold tension without stretching, keeping the spheres at consistent drop heights over time.
The IP20 rating limits the Illusis to dry interior spaces only — not suitable for bathrooms or outdoor covered areas. The chrome canopy measures 405mm across and requires a ceiling rose capable of supporting approximately 3kg once bulbs are fitted. The fitting is dimmable when paired with compatible G9 dimmable bulbs and a trailing-edge dimmer switch.

Frequently Asked
What bulbs does it take and are they included?
The Illusis takes eight G9 capsule bulbs, sold separately. G9 bulbs are available in halogen (typically 28W-40W) and LED (3W-5W equivalent). For the best light output paired with the glass spheres, warm white LEDs at 2700K-3000K work well.
Is it dimmable?
Yes, but only when paired with dimmable G9 bulbs and a compatible trailing-edge dimmer switch. Not all G9 LED bulbs are dimmable, so check the bulb specification before pairing with a dimmer.
What ceiling height does it suit?
The semi-flush design works in rooms with standard 2.4m ceilings. The glass sphere droplets extend approximately 250mm below the chrome canopy, so the lowest spheres hang around 2.15m above the floor when fitted to a 2.4m ceiling.
